I'd stay away from the Zire, especially with the M105 at roughly the same price point. Only 2MB of memory, no backlight and no cradle. Doesn't sound like much of a bargain, rechargeable Lithium-ion battery or no...
It looks like new 8MB Handspring Visor Neo or Deluxe go for around $90-$110 on eBay, so that might be a better option.
